public inbox for gentoo-commits@lists.gentoo.org
 help / color / mirror / Atom feed
From: "Johannes Huber" <johu@gentoo.org>
To: gentoo-commits@lists.gentoo.org
Subject: [gentoo-commits] proj/kde:master commit in: kde-apps/okular/
Date: Thu,  3 Nov 2016 22:07:28 +0000 (UTC)	[thread overview]
Message-ID: <1478210828.f14944854e99909634f8ae7bb8c02d7f00e70fe6.johu@gentoo> (raw)

commit:     f14944854e99909634f8ae7bb8c02d7f00e70fe6
Author:     Andreas Sturmlechner <andreas.sturmlechner <AT> gmail <DOT> com>
AuthorDate: Thu Nov  3 21:52:56 2016 +0000
Commit:     Johannes Huber <johu <AT> gentoo <DOT> org>
CommitDate: Thu Nov  3 22:07:08 2016 +0000
URL:        https://gitweb.gentoo.org/proj/kde.git/commit/?id=f1494485

kde-apps/okular: Frameworks merged to master

Package-Manager: portage-2.3.0

Signed-off-by: Johannes Huber <johu <AT> gentoo.org>

 kde-apps/okular/okular-5.9999.ebuild | 76 ------------------------------------
 kde-apps/okular/okular-9999.ebuild   | 71 ++++++++++++++++++++-------------
 2 files changed, 44 insertions(+), 103 deletions(-)

diff --git a/kde-apps/okular/okular-5.9999.ebuild b/kde-apps/okular/okular-5.9999.ebuild
deleted file mode 100644
index ff291a9..0000000
--- a/kde-apps/okular/okular-5.9999.ebuild
+++ /dev/null
@@ -1,76 +0,0 @@
-# Copyright 1999-2016 Gentoo Foundation
-# Distributed under the terms of the GNU General Public License v2
-# $Id$
-
-EAPI=6
-
-KDE_HANDBOOK="forceoptional"
-KDE_TEST="forceoptional"
-EGIT_BRANCH="frameworks"
-inherit kde5
-
-DESCRIPTION="Universal document viewer based on KDE Frameworks"
-HOMEPAGE="https://okular.kde.org https://www.kde.org/applications/graphics/okular"
-KEYWORDS=""
-IUSE="chm crypt djvu ebook +jpeg mobi +pdf +postscript speech +tiff"
-
-DEPEND="
-	$(add_frameworks_dep kactivities)
-	$(add_frameworks_dep karchive)
-	$(add_frameworks_dep kbookmarks)
-	$(add_frameworks_dep kcompletion)
-	$(add_frameworks_dep kconfig)
-	$(add_frameworks_dep kconfigwidgets)
-	$(add_frameworks_dep kcoreaddons)
-	$(add_frameworks_dep kdbusaddons)
-	$(add_frameworks_dep khtml)
-	$(add_frameworks_dep kio)
-	$(add_frameworks_dep kjs)
-	$(add_frameworks_dep kparts)
-	$(add_frameworks_dep kwallet)
-	$(add_frameworks_dep threadweaver)
-	$(add_qt_dep qtdbus)
-	$(add_qt_dep qtgui)
-	$(add_qt_dep qtprintsupport)
-	$(add_qt_dep qtsvg)
-	$(add_qt_dep qtwidgets)
-	media-libs/freetype
-	media-libs/phonon[qt5]
-	sys-libs/zlib
-	chm? ( dev-libs/chmlib )
-	crypt? ( app-crypt/qca:2[qt5] )
-	djvu? ( app-text/djvu )
-	ebook? ( app-text/ebook-tools )
-	jpeg? (
-		$(add_kdeapps_dep libkexiv2)
-		virtual/jpeg:0
-	)
-	mobi? ( $(add_kdeapps_dep kdegraphics-mobipocket) )
-	pdf? ( app-text/poppler[qt5,-exceptions(-)] )
-	postscript? ( app-text/libspectre )
-	speech? ( $(add_qt_dep qtspeech) )
-	tiff? ( media-libs/tiff:0 )
-"
-RDEPEND="${DEPEND}"
-
-src_prepare() {
-	kde5_src_prepare
-	use test || cmake_comment_add_subdirectory conf/autotests
-}
-
-src_configure() {
-	local mycmakeargs=(
-		$(cmake-utils_use_find_package chm CHM)
-		$(cmake-utils_use_find_package crypt Qca-qt5)
-		$(cmake-utils_use_find_package djvu DjVuLibre)
-		$(cmake-utils_use_find_package ebook EPub)
-		$(cmake-utils_use_find_package jpeg KF5KExiv2)
-		$(cmake-utils_use_find_package mobi QMobipocket)
-		$(cmake-utils_use_find_package pdf Poppler)
-		$(cmake-utils_use_find_package postscript LibSpectre)
-		$(cmake-utils_use_find_package speech Qt5TextToSpeech)
-		$(cmake-utils_use_find_package tiff TIFF)
-	)
-
-	kde5_src_configure
-}

diff --git a/kde-apps/okular/okular-9999.ebuild b/kde-apps/okular/okular-9999.ebuild
index 4962501..324abb4 100644
--- a/kde-apps/okular/okular-9999.ebuild
+++ b/kde-apps/okular/okular-9999.ebuild
@@ -4,55 +4,72 @@
 
 EAPI=6
 
-KDE_HANDBOOK="optional"
-#VIRTUALX_REQUIRED=test
-RESTRICT=test
-# test 2: parttest hangs
+KDE_HANDBOOK="forceoptional"
+KDE_TEST="forceoptional"
+inherit kde5
 
-inherit kde4-base
-
-DESCRIPTION="Universal document viewer based on KPDF"
+DESCRIPTION="Universal document viewer based on KDE Frameworks"
 HOMEPAGE="https://okular.kde.org https://www.kde.org/applications/graphics/okular"
 KEYWORDS=""
-IUSE="chm crypt debug djvu dpi ebook +jpeg mobi +postscript +pdf +tiff"
+IUSE="chm crypt djvu ebook +jpeg mobi +pdf +postscript speech +tiff"
 
 DEPEND="
+	$(add_frameworks_dep kactivities)
+	$(add_frameworks_dep karchive)
+	$(add_frameworks_dep kbookmarks)
+	$(add_frameworks_dep kcompletion)
+	$(add_frameworks_dep kconfig)
+	$(add_frameworks_dep kconfigwidgets)
+	$(add_frameworks_dep kcoreaddons)
+	$(add_frameworks_dep kdbusaddons)
+	$(add_frameworks_dep khtml)
+	$(add_frameworks_dep kio)
+	$(add_frameworks_dep kjs)
+	$(add_frameworks_dep kparts)
+	$(add_frameworks_dep kwallet)
+	$(add_frameworks_dep threadweaver)
+	$(add_qt_dep qtdbus)
+	$(add_qt_dep qtgui)
+	$(add_qt_dep qtprintsupport)
+	$(add_qt_dep qtsvg)
+	$(add_qt_dep qtwidgets)
 	media-libs/freetype
-	media-libs/phonon[qt4]
-	media-libs/qimageblitz
+	media-libs/phonon[qt5]
 	sys-libs/zlib
 	chm? ( dev-libs/chmlib )
-	crypt? ( app-crypt/qca:2[qt4] )
+	crypt? ( app-crypt/qca:2[qt5] )
 	djvu? ( app-text/djvu )
-	dpi? ( x11-libs/libkscreen:4 )
 	ebook? ( app-text/ebook-tools )
 	jpeg? (
 		$(add_kdeapps_dep libkexiv2)
 		virtual/jpeg:0
 	)
 	mobi? ( $(add_kdeapps_dep kdegraphics-mobipocket) )
-	pdf? ( >=app-text/poppler-0.20[qt4,-exceptions(-)] )
+	pdf? ( app-text/poppler[qt5,-exceptions(-)] )
 	postscript? ( app-text/libspectre )
+	speech? ( $(add_qt_dep qtspeech) )
 	tiff? ( media-libs/tiff:0 )
 "
 RDEPEND="${DEPEND}"
 
+src_prepare() {
+	kde5_src_prepare
+	use test || cmake_comment_add_subdirectory conf/autotests
+}
+
 src_configure() {
 	local mycmakeargs=(
-		-DWITH_KActivities=OFF
-		-DWITH_CHM=$(usex chm)
-		-DWITH_QCA2=$(usex crypt)
-		-DWITH_DjVuLibre=$(usex djvu)
-		-DWITH_LibKScreen=$(usex dpi)
-		-DWITH_EPub=$(usex ebook)
-		-DWITH_JPEG=$(usex jpeg)
-		-DWITH_Kexiv2=$(usex jpeg)
-		-DWITH_QMobipocket=$(usex mobi)
-		-DWITH_LibSpectre=$(usex postscript)
-		-DWITH_PopplerQt4=$(usex pdf)
-		-DWITH_Poppler=$(usex pdf)
-		-DWITH_TIFF=$(usex tiff)
+		$(cmake-utils_use_find_package chm CHM)
+		$(cmake-utils_use_find_package crypt Qca-qt5)
+		$(cmake-utils_use_find_package djvu DjVuLibre)
+		$(cmake-utils_use_find_package ebook EPub)
+		$(cmake-utils_use_find_package jpeg KF5KExiv2)
+		$(cmake-utils_use_find_package mobi QMobipocket)
+		$(cmake-utils_use_find_package pdf Poppler)
+		$(cmake-utils_use_find_package postscript LibSpectre)
+		$(cmake-utils_use_find_package speech Qt5TextToSpeech)
+		$(cmake-utils_use_find_package tiff TIFF)
 	)
 
-	kde4-base_src_configure
+	kde5_src_configure
 }


             reply	other threads:[~2016-11-03 22:07 UTC|newest]

Thread overview: 60+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2016-11-03 22:07 Johannes Huber [this message]
  -- strict thread matches above, loose matches on Subject: below --
2024-11-20 16:11 [gentoo-commits] proj/kde:master commit in: kde-apps/okular/ Andreas Sturmlechner
2024-11-10 16:46 Andreas Sturmlechner
2024-11-04 23:01 Andreas Sturmlechner
2024-02-27  0:18 Sam James
2024-02-26 23:22 Sam James
2024-02-25 19:24 Sam James
2023-12-21 11:46 Andreas Sturmlechner
2023-08-06 10:04 Andreas Sturmlechner
2023-03-23 22:10 Andreas Sturmlechner
2023-02-02 10:30 Andreas Sturmlechner
2022-12-16 19:33 Andreas Sturmlechner
2022-11-11 23:18 Andreas Sturmlechner
2022-10-06  9:02 Andreas Sturmlechner
2022-09-08 14:22 Andreas Sturmlechner
2022-07-17 11:54 Andreas Sturmlechner
2022-05-09  5:39 Andreas Sturmlechner
2022-05-08 13:33 Andreas Sturmlechner
2022-02-04 12:38 Andreas Sturmlechner
2021-11-24 19:41 Andreas Sturmlechner
2021-11-13 19:05 Andreas Sturmlechner
2021-11-04 13:22 Andreas Sturmlechner
2021-08-03 15:00 Andreas Sturmlechner
2020-12-25 21:51 Andreas Sturmlechner
2020-11-25 13:23 Andreas Sturmlechner
2020-10-31  9:26 Andreas Sturmlechner
2020-10-25  0:26 Andreas Sturmlechner
2020-02-22 19:52 Andreas Sturmlechner
2019-01-16  8:50 Andreas Sturmlechner
2018-08-16 20:26 Andreas Sturmlechner
2018-04-13 20:38 Andreas Sturmlechner
2018-03-19 17:15 Andreas Sturmlechner
2018-02-22 13:17 Andreas Sturmlechner
2018-02-01  1:05 Andreas Sturmlechner
2017-10-19 13:34 Andreas Sturmlechner
2017-08-25 18:33 Andreas Sturmlechner
2017-07-13 17:48 Andreas Sturmlechner
2017-07-13 17:48 Andreas Sturmlechner
2017-06-24 14:39 Andreas Sturmlechner
2017-04-23 13:36 Andreas Sturmlechner
2017-04-22 13:15 Andreas Sturmlechner
2017-04-22  8:41 Andreas Sturmlechner
2017-02-10 11:27 Andreas Sturmlechner
2017-01-10  8:33 Johannes Huber
2017-01-10  8:16 Johannes Huber
2017-01-10  8:15 Johannes Huber
2016-12-20 18:28 Johannes Huber
2016-12-19 20:18 Johannes Huber
2016-11-05 12:28 Johannes Huber
2016-11-02 19:08 Johannes Huber
2016-07-25 15:35 Michael Palimaka
2016-06-19 13:29 Michael Palimaka
2016-04-07 19:23 Johannes Huber
2016-03-09  5:01 Michael Palimaka
2016-01-31 15:53 Michael Palimaka
2016-01-10 15:14 Michael Palimaka
2015-12-10  6:42 Michael Palimaka
2015-02-17 13:48 Michael Palimaka
2015-01-28 23:54 Johannes Huber
2015-01-28 14:11 Michael Palimaka

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=1478210828.f14944854e99909634f8ae7bb8c02d7f00e70fe6.johu@gentoo \
    --to=johu@gentoo.org \
    --cc=gentoo-commits@lists.gentoo.org \
    --cc=gentoo-dev@lists.gentoo.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ox